Which side of the plane to sit from George Bush Intercontinental Houston Airport (Houston) to Tocumen International Airport (Panama City)?
Right Side of the Plane
While both sides offer expansive ocean views, the right side is generally superior for the approach into Panama City, providing iconic views of the Pacific entrance to the Panama Canal, the Bridge of the Americas, and the modern skyline.
Galveston Island
Clear views of the Galveston seawall, historic district, and the narrow barrier island beaches.
Central American Coastline
Intermittent views of the rugged coastlines of Honduras and Nicaragua depending on the specific flight corridor.
Panama City Skyline
The 'Dubai of Latin America' features a dramatic wall of skyscrapers reflecting off the Pacific Ocean.
Panama Canal Entrance
The Pacific mouth of the canal, including the Bridge of the Americas and the line of ships waiting to transit.
Bay of Panama
An incredible view of dozens of massive cargo ships anchored in the bay, creating an industrial constellation on the water.
The right side is the 'money side' for this route. Aim for an afternoon arrival to see the Panama City skyline illuminated by the setting sun. Request a seat behind the wing to ensure the engine doesn't block the view of the Canal entrance during the final banking turns into PTY.
East Texas Marshlands
Aerial views of the complex bayous and coastal wetlands east of Houston immediately after takeoff.
Gulf of Mexico
Deep blue waters of the Gulf, often dotted with oil platforms and cargo vessels in the shipping lanes.
San Blas Islands
If the flight path hugs the eastern coast, you may spot the tiny coral atolls of the Guna Yala archipelago.
Port of Colรณn
The massive Atlantic container terminals and the northern start of the Panama Canal during the descent.
Sit on the left if you prefer a morning flight where the sun is behind you, reducing glare. During the final descent, look for the Gatun Lake and the lush rainforests of the Caribbean side. Watch for the massive breakwaters protecting the Atlantic entrance.
